Latest Patents
Gaudry holds a patent for a "Magnetic circuit and induction device including the same." This invention relates to a magnetic circuit for inductance devices and an induction device that incorporates such a circuit. The novel magnetic circuit is designed as a parallelepipedic bar of magnetic material featuring at least two substantially superimposed grooves. The circuit is H-shaped in a plane perpendicular to the grooves, with the lower branches providing electrical connection means. This design allows for easy and efficient fixation onto printed circuits or hybrid circuit supports, making the induction devices particularly suitable for miniaturization.
